Dhanush, Vijay Sethupathi & D.Imman Celebrates The Glory Of Receiving A Prestigious Award At The 67th National Film Awards!

by Monisha Vijaya Segaran
March 23, 2021
48
SHARES
Share on FacebookShare on TwitterSend

The 67th National Film Awards were announced on Monday, after being deferred indefinitely due to the coronavirus pandemic. The 67th National Film Awards, which were announced yesterday, were a treasure trove for Tamil filmmakers.

Overall, Kollywood took home 7 awards, including Best Actor for Dhanush, for his outstanding performance as a father attempting to save his son in Vetri Maaran’s action drama Asuran, which was also named Best Tamil Film.

Dhanush garnered the Best Actor award for his role in Asuran, while the film also won the Best Tamil Film Award for 2019.

Vetri Maaran directed Asuran and released by Kalaipuli S Thanu was inspired by Poomani’s Tamil novel Vekkai.

Asuran was also screened as one of the 10 films shown at the 76th Golden Globes.

This is Dhanush’s second National Award; he previously received one for the film Aadukalam (2011), which was also directed by Vetri Maaran. 

Embracing Vijay Sethupathi’s first National Award for his moving depiction of a trans person in Thiagarajan Kumararaja’s Super Deluxe, he won the Best Supporting Actor award.

This must-have award has surely been a surreal moment for the staggering actor!

More joy came showering upon Kollywood after D.Imman received the National Award as well.

The Best Music award was presented to D. Imman for his melancholy songs in Ajith’s  Viswasam.

Kollywood’s achievement was elevated by Oththa Seruppu Size 7. 

Oththa Seruppu Size 7 by Radhakrishnan Parthiban won the Special Jury Award, as well as the Best Audiography Award for their sound designer, the Oscar-winning Resul Pookutty.
